The C.O.P. Bike Park Needs You!
May 9, 2008Published by bruleAfter having one of the most successful volunteer days we've ever seen at Canada Olympic Park in our bike park this past Saturday, we are asking for help once again!
The snow that has hit Calgary for the third time this spring has slowed our redevelopment progress once again. We considered pushing back our opening by another week but have decided that if we can get the help we need next week, we will be able to open at least a portion of our new bike park on May 17. We have decided to push the Springin' Open event to May 24. Gravity Logic and our trail crew have been working as hard as they can to get our park ready for the 17th and it looks like we could use a hand for the homestretch! When: next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day evenings at Canada Olympic Park from 4 – 8 p.m. More info: Check in at C.O.P.'s Guest Services to fill out a waiver on those days and then take your rake and shovel to the trees! We've had such amazing support from the Calgary bike community and to say we appreciate it is a major understatement. This is our last long haul before we open and could use all the help we can get! If you've got an evening or two free and want to be part of this amazing project, come check us out… See you all next week! Sarah Leishman Canada Olympic Park www.canadaolympicpark.ca |
